5b ss will not start
my dad went to run his 5bss today, and it wouldn't start at all, normally it starts on the second pull. we checked it, and it still is getting spark, and we reset the gap. so any help will be appreciated

RE: 5b ss will not start
whenever my baja refuses to start i:
A. set carb to factory setting.
B. make sure engine is not flooded. if it is, close low speed needle, start the engine, and open the valve back up before it stalls out.
after that, it usually starts. if it doesnt, replace spark plug. and make sure it is getting fuel.
if that fails, their is usually more problems with the carb or engine.

RE: 5b ss will not start
try a few drops of fuel down in to the carb to see if its fuel or compression related if your getting spark its either fuel or compression related.....
if you get ignition of the fuel (well full ignition and running for a few seconds) its fuel related if not its compression related

RE: 5b ss will not start
its almost ALWAYS the spark plug. these 23cc trucks use such a high oil content, that i find the plugs foul a lot faster than most other 2 strokes. keep a pile of them on hand always, and always check That first, because even if the plug Looks like its sparking, and not fouled, it can still be bad.
